Core Viewpoint - The article criticizes the recent trial of Venezuelan President Maduro in a U.S. court as an act of "judicial hegemony" and a violation of international law, asserting that it represents a blatant display of power politics by the U.S. [1][2][3] Group 1: Legal and International Relations - The trial is deemed illegal under international law, which grants heads of state absolute immunity in foreign courts, regardless of U.S. recognition of Maduro as president [1] - The U.S. actions are characterized as a violation of the principles of sovereignty, non-interference, and peaceful resolution of international disputes as outlined in the UN Charter [2] - The U.S. is accused of prioritizing its domestic laws over international law, positioning itself as an "international judge" and undermining multilateralism [3] Group 2: U.S. Foreign Policy and Military Actions - The article highlights a history of U.S. military interventions, such as in Panama and Venezuela, as examples of its long-standing hegemonic behavior [3] - The U.S. is portrayed as relying on coercion, sanctions, and military actions to maintain its so-called leadership, which ultimately undermines its global respect [3] - The narrative suggests that the U.S. is acting recklessly and unlawfully, with its recent actions being the latest in a series of imperialistic endeavors [2][3]
